Transaction 595d4681131625c8b824cd1989fab27328fa54ac4df54dc0be36e4f567e93f3d

1 Input
2 Outputs
  • 595d4681131625c8b824cd1989fab27328fa54ac4df54dc0be36e4f567e93f3d:0
  • value  412592
    address  3H2rNgZLsowiRDkWEUCCeteEysi1AhzKir
  • 595d4681131625c8b824cd1989fab27328fa54ac4df54dc0be36e4f567e93f3d:1
  • value  2495039
    address  124qx2fVHzjr74FBrq3YVNPov4ZN6iwo8t